Related: Editorials & Other Articles, Issue Forums, Alliance Forums, Region Forums[Chief] Val Demings (D-FL) makes it official, files to run against Republican U.S. Sen. Marco Rubio
USA Today via Yahoo NewsIf there is legislation on the table that is good for Florida Im going to support that legislation; if its bad for Florida or bad for Floridians, Im not going to support it, said Demings, who has served in Congress since 2016. Time and time again, we have seen (Rubio) play political games.
She cited Rubio, who joined with fellow Florida Republican U.S. Sen. Rick Scott in voting against the Biden administrations $1 trillion infrastructure bill last year. The package has brought billions of dollars of transportation, broadband and electric vehicle charging stations into the state.
Demings, who supported the legislation in the U.S. House, said Rubio was willing to hurt his state to side with fellow Republicans.
